1 Control Elements
and Connections
1.1 Mixing amplifier PA-2510D /-2520D
1 Cover of the insertion compartment;
an insertion module from MONACOR can be
installed here, e. g. tuner, CD player, mes-
sage storage module
2 Volume controls for the input channels
CH 1 – 6
3 Bass controls and treble controls to adjust the
sound for the input channels CH 1 – 6
4 Buttons to switch the siren tones on and off;
when a siren is switched on, the LED above
the corresponding button will light up
⁓ repeated wailing (tone rising and falling)
— rising tone followed by continuous tone
5 Button CHIME to trigger the chime
6 Control MASTER to adjust the total volume
7 LED indicators
SIGNAL:
sum signal indicator
CLIP:
overload indicator
PROT:
lights up in case of an amplifier
failure (e. g. due to overload or
overheating) and lights up
briefly when the amplifier is
switched on
8 LED indicators
STAND-BY: standby mode
ON:
operating mode
The LED will flash when the
amplifier is remote-controlled
via the zone paging microphone
PA-2500RC or when a switch-
ing contact at the terminals E / M
MESSAGE CTRL (20) is closed
for an emergency announce-
ment.
9 Button POWER; to switch off the amplifier,
keep the button pressed for a few seconds
10 Reset pushbutton for the overload protection
of the switch-mode power supply (use a thin,
non-conductive object to press the pushbut-
ton)
11 Zone selection buttons
1 – 10: zones Z 1 – 10 (PA-2510D)
1 – 20: zones Z 1 – 20 (PA-2520D)
ALL: all zones (of the corresponding row of
buttons)
When the button is pressed again (for
2 seconds), the previous selection will
apply again.
12 PA-2510D only:
Buttons VOL
and VOL
to select the zone
volume
13 Plug-in screw terminals (removable) for the
100 V speakers of the zones Z 1 – 10 or
Z 1 – 20
Attention! The output Z 1 can be loaded with
a power of max. 250 W
, the other outputs
RMS
can be loaded with up to 50 W
total load of all zones may never exceed
250 W
.
RMS
14 Mains jack for connection to a mains socket
(230 V~ / 50 Hz) via the mains cable supplied
15 Support for the mains fuse
Always replace a blown fuse by one of the
same type!
16 Fuse for the 24 V emergency power supply
Always replace a blown fuse by one of the
same type!
17 Plug-in screw terminals LOW IMP for a low-
impedance speaker with a minimum imped-
ance of 4 Ω, regardless of the zone selection
Never use this output simultaneously with the
100 V outputs (13); the amplifier may be over-
loaded.
18 Screw terminals for emergency power supply
(24 V )
19 Plug-in screw terminals PAGING IN to con-
nect a signal source with line level output for
announcements of higher priority (
fig. 5, chapter 3)
20 Plug-in screw terminals to connect normally
open contacts for remote control of various
functions
E / M MESSAGE CTRL – The amplifier will
be switched on. For emergency announce-
ments, all zones will be selected; for the
model PA-2510D, the zone volume will be set
to −3 dB.
The LED ON (8) will start flashing. If a mes-
sage storage module (e. g. PA-1120-DMT) is
installed, a stored emergency announcement
can automatically be reproduced.
CHIME CTRL – trigger a chime
POWER REMOTE – switch the amplifier on
and off by remote control
21 Control PAGING to adjust the volume of a
signal source at the input terminals PAGING
IN (19)
22 Control CHIME/SIREN to adjust the volume
of the chime sounds and siren sounds
23 Connections REC 0 dB (RCA jacks) for a
recorder
L (left) and R (right) jacks are provided for
stereo recorders. Since the amplifier is mono-
phonic, the signals at the two jacks are iden-
tical.
24 Inputs LINE IN −10 dB (RCA jacks) for the
channels CH 5 and CH 6; L (left) and R (right)
jacks are provided for stereo signal sources.
Since the amplifier is monophonic, the stereo
signals are internally transformed into a mono
signal.
25 Input for microphone level and line level
(combined XLR / 6.3 mm jack), balanced; one
input for each of the input channels CH 1 – 4
26 Switch PHANTOM; one switch for each of the
input channels CH 1 – 4; when the switch is
engaged, a voltage of 15 V
powered microphones will be available at the
XLR contacts of the input jack (25)
Caution: To prevent loud switching noise, use the
switch only when the amplifier has been switched
off, the outputs have been muted or the control
MASTER (6) has been set to "0". In addition, no
microphone with unbalanced signal output may be
connected when phantom power has been acti-
vated; otherwise, the microphone may be damaged.
27 Control GAIN to match the input amplification
with the signal source (microphone level to
line level); one control for each of the chan-
